Mercury vs Fever: Clark and Thomas Set Up a High-Value Creation Matchup
Indiana’s home game against Phoenix should draw attention because of Clark, but the real market edge may come from how each team creates offense. Clark can speed the game up, bend defensive coverage and create open threes through pace. Thomas can slow the game down, manipulate help defense and generate cleaner half-court looks through passing.
That contrast matters for the total. If Indiana runs and gets early threes, the game can play faster. If Phoenix controls half-court tempo and forces longer possessions, the total can become more fragile.
The revenge angle also matters. Indiana recently came back from a double-digit deficit to beat Phoenix, so the market may overreact toward Fever spread. Phoenix now has fresh coverage information on Clark and Kelsey Mitchell, which makes first quarter and live markets especially important.

Phoenix’s Adjustment Path
Phoenix’s best path is not just making shots. It needs cleaner early possessions, better defensive communication against Clark and more control in the first quarter. If Mercury starts stronger than it did in the previous meeting, Phoenix spread and first-quarter markets become more interesting.
Thomas assists should be watched closely. If her line is still priced as a standard playmaking prop and not as the center of Phoenix’s half-court offense, there may be value.

Dream vs Valkyries: Atlanta’s Rebounding Edge Tests Golden State
Atlanta arrives with one of the strongest profiles in the league: record, defense, rebounding and multiple double-digit scorers. That makes the Dream a difficult road opponent, especially against a Golden State team trying to respond after consecutive losses.
Angel Reese rebounds should be one of the first props to check if available. Atlanta offensive rebounds and second-chance points can tilt the game if Golden State does not finish defensive possessions.
Golden State’s path is home energy and shooting. If the Valkyries hit early threes, they can make Atlanta defend in space and push the total higher. If Golden State starts cold, Atlanta’s rebounding edge can create a fast separation.
